We are recruiting for a family/carer peer worker to join our peer work team, providing support to carers and family member of consumer who have accessed our Youth Unit in Dandenong Hospital. This role requires lived experience of caring for someone (a close friend or family member) with a significant mental illness. (Please note, this role has not been created for persons who have worked only as a carer in a paid employment capacity).

The role will require the successful applicant to work across a 5 day Monday - Friday roster.

**About The Role**

Based in our Dandenong Youth Unit, you will work as part of the multidisciplinary team to provide valuable peer support to family members and carers of consumers during their inpatient admission and for up to 28 days post discharge. This position will be based at Dandenong hospital, but you may be required to work across our other sites (Clayton and Casey hospitals)

**About You**

You will have lived experience of caring for someone with a significant mental illness, and have the ability to share your lived experience, as appropriate, to support other carers to help built understanding, hope, and resilience in line with peer support principles.
